Specifically the line that reads:

"Ennan Production Bonus: an additional Type I Mass Replicator was constructed."

I've been playing BotF for a loooong time and I've never seen that, at least i'm 90% sure. Does anyone know how often this can happen/how to make it happen?

Yeah I have seen it before, ircc it is a random event based on morale (can not find topic on subject right now)

How to duplicate/increase chance? That would be tough if there is a bit mask for this you could increase value but still would require high morale.

But needless to say it is rare.

Yeah, I've seen that before as well (although as 'chero noted, it's fairly rare). It only occurs in systems with high morale, and only when random events are enabled.

I'm pretty sure you don't need random events turned on for it to happen. Maybe for the message about it happening but not for it to happen. Why, because this happens all too often for me. Long ago I read through one of Gowrons post which explained the value, or bonus, of having numbers of buildings equalling a number that devides evenly into 100: 2, 5, 10, 20, 25, & 50. When you have structures totalling this many, you get a bonus because of how the code calculates output. Depending on TL sometimes its better to have 25 construction yards than 26 for example. Or perhaps you could build and fill 30 but you might be better staying at 25 and adding 5 intel buildings etc.
So I get really annoyed when half my systems end up with 11 construction yards or universities or intel structures when I know 10 gives me a bonus. Particularly if the 11th isnt even filled. I get no value from the unoccupied 11th structure and I loose the bonus becuse now total structures dont devide evenly into 100. I hate it when systems take it apon themselves to build an extra structure. Wish I could disable this little "Bonus" (sarcasm)
